Job Summary
The Athletic Training Fellow will provide quality health care primarily to their assigned sport. The Athletic Training Fellow will be responsible for all aspects of health care including, but not limited to: practice coverage, competition coverage, treatment, rehabilitation, post-injury care, and injury prevention. Additional administrative duties will be assigned by the Head Athletic Trainer.
